Alligators are a prehistoric animal dating back more than 150 million years. Once on the endangered list they have made a remarkable recovery with over 1 million in Florida alone. Alligators live over 50 years and can grow to 15 feet or more.

Caring for your headcover

Each cover is built from premium materials selected for the best feel and durability on the course. A few simple habits keep them looking new:

  • Spot-clean with a damp cloth and mild soap. Air-dry — never tumble dry.
  • Avoid prolonged direct sunlight to keep colors crisp.
  • Store in a dry place; if your bag is wet, let the cover air-dry separately.
  • For knit covers: keep clear of velcro to avoid pulls.
